titleOfInvention System and method for sensing flow and user interface for monitoring material flow in a structure
abstract A system for sensing flow material in a fluid-holding structure is disclosed. The system has an assembly including a housing, a communication device disposed at least partially in the housing, a controller disposed at least partially in the housing, a sensor array disposed at least partially in the housing, and an external-surface-mounting attachment portion configured to non-intrusively attach the assembly to a surface. The system also has a user interface configured to display a graphical element. The sensor array includes a pressure sensor, a density sensor, a corrosion sensor, and a vibration sensor. The controller controls the communication device to transmit sensed data collected by the sensor array to the user interface. The sensed data includes at least one of a density data sensed by the density sensor and a corrosion data sensed by the corrosion sensor. Display of the graphical element varies based on the sensed data.
